Searching for a job online can be frustrating. Having once experienced this firsthand, Candice Setareh is on a mission to make online job searches easier by creating Myfuturejob.net, an online career resource for career-oriented Gen Y professionals.
Setareh’s unique approach to job listings starts with personalization. Myfuturejob.net aims to offer personal and professional support to online job-seekers that is not readily available through other job listing websites. Setareh’s mission is to ultimately become a go-to online resource for Gen Y professionals.
The Gen Y job site explains that, “the formative years of your career path can sometimes be hard to interpret.” Therefore, their mission is to provide an all-encompassing site that offers insight on the ‘how to and why moments’ every young professional experiences during their job search.

How I Got Started:
After graduating from college, I was working full-time, and was planning on applying to graduate school. After applying, I realized that I had applied for all the wrong reasons. Instead, I wanted to pursue a career that I was more passionate about.
So, I started brainstorming about what I wanted do for the rest of my life. I recalled utilizing a number of different online job platforms at once to help me during this process, yet I was constantly frustrated by the lack of personal and professional career support that was available in one space.
I quickly learned that my friends and peers shared in my frustration. So, with much delight, I was constantly thinking of ways of improving the [job search] platform, and providing career support. That was the beginning of my path to creating myfuturejob.net, an online career resource for aspiring men and women of Generation Y.
We understand that the formative years of your career path can sometimes be hard to interpret. Our mission is to provide an all-encompassing site that offers insight on the “how to” and “why” moments every young professional experiences during this time. My hope is that myfuturejob.net inspires people to dream big, reach their full potential and achieve their professional dreams.
